  • La Grand Place: This iconic square, located 621m from the Northern Quarter, is a stunning example of Gothic and Baroque architecture. Surrounded by ornate guildhalls, it buzzes with cultural events and vibrant atmosphere, making it a must-visit for history enthusiasts.
  • Tour & Taxis: Situated 249m away, this former freight depot has been transformed into a bustling convention centre. It blends modern business vibes with historical charm, hosting various events and exhibitions, perfect for networking and exploration.
  • Atomium: Located 1.2km from the Northern Quarter, this unique museum is shaped like an iron crystal magnified 165 billion times. It offers captivating exhibitions and panoramic views of Brussels, showcasing the city’s rich culture and innovation.

The nearest major airports for your trip to Northern Quarter

For your visit to the Northern Quarter in Brussels, the main airport options are Brussels Airport (BRU), located 3.7km away, and Charleroi Airport (CRL), situated 17.4km from the area.
